Marco Island Calusa Garden Club concludes its winter speaker series
The Calusa Garden Club of Marco Island presents speakers for the community to enjoy. The speakers present on a variety of subjects, from environmental concerns, area nature preserves, organic gardening and horticulture to underwater reefs.
The club’s lineup of speakers for winter of 2018 included Dr. Martin Price of Echo Global Farm in January, Patrick Higgins of Friends of Fakahatchee Strand in February and Danny Cox of Naples Botanical Gardens in March.
On Feb. 12, club members and about 15 community guests enjoyed a virtual tour of Fakahatchee Strand Preserve State Park in a presentation by Higgins, President of the Board of Friends of Fakahatchee Strand. Audience members viewed Fakatchee Strand through maps and pictures which gave them an idea of the importance of Fakahatchee Strand Preserve in the ecosystem of southwest Florida.
Higgins’ pictures of Fakahatchee Strand State Park featured the flora and fauna of the Strand, including orchids, grasslands, frogs, alligators and wading birds as well as ferns, palms, cypress trees and grasses. Higgins also gave attendees the viewpoint of visitors to the park by showing pictures of visitors in the Ghostrider Tram, on swamp walks and on the Big Cypress Bend boardwalk.
For more information about the park, Higgins directed audience members to the Friends of Fakahatchee Strand website orchidswamp.org.
Before the Calusa Garden Club meeting, members participated in a floral design workshop.
On Monday, Cox, the aquatic plant director at the Naples Botanical Garden, addressed the Calusa Garden Club and the community. He discussed and presented pictures of water garden plants and beautiful water gardens.
Calusa Garden Club of Marco Island is a member of the Florida Federation of Garden Clubs. Membership is open to those interested in horticulture, floral design and environmental matters who reside five months or more in Collier County.
Calusa Garden Club welcomes visitors interested in its educational programs and visitors interested in membership.
